UNIVERSIDAD NACIONAL AUTÓNOMA DE ALTO AMAZONAS

Universidad Nacional Autónoma de Alto Amazonas (UNAAA)
© Universidad Nacional Autónoma de Alto Amazonas (UNAAA)
27 August, 2020

Universidad Nacional Autónoma de Alto Amazonas (UNAAA) is a public academic institution oriented to professional training, scientific research, technological innovation and social responsibility at the highest level of quality.

It preserves and disseminates the Amazonian culture, integrates it as one of the fundamental features of Peruvian culture and promotes it as a heritage of humanity. Within this context, it cultivates the contributions of universal culture, especially that which means human development and quality of life.

Its main educational task is oriented towards humanistic, scientific, technological and innovation training, with a clear ecological, ethnic, cultural, business and productive awareness.

According to its website, “UNAAA is an academic community oriented towards research and teaching, which provides humanistic, scientific and technological training with a clear awareness of our country as a multicultural reality. It adopts the concept of education as a fundamental right and an essential public service. Made up of teachers, students and graduates ”.
